ABOUT Jackson:
Jackson was the love of my life. The happiest day of my life so far was the day I brought his little puppy-butt home with me. Unfortunately, he was sick from the time he was born, but I will always feel fortunate for the time, although all too short, that I had with him. He loved to go for walks, sneak treats (he was on a special diet), but his absolute favorite was his toy piggy, which I still have some place special. He brought me joy and comfort and I hope I made him happy, too. His sister, Holly, and I miss him very much. He passed in December of 2008. He was famous for his super long tongue that always hung out-even when he ate, slept and barked! his snore and his loving personality. Miss you baby boy.
